How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 76247?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
76247 Studio Apartments | $1,491 | $1,299 | $2,042 |
76247 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,720 | $553 | $4,677 |
76247 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,353 | $661 | $6,024 |
76247 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,798 | $767 | $9,218 |
76247 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,441 | $1,969 | $3,595 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 76247 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 76247?
There are currently 4 Studio Apartments in 76247 with rent ranges from $1,299 to $2,042 with an average price of $1,491.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 76247 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 76247 ranges from $553 to $4,677 with an average monthly rent of $1,720.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 76247 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 76247 range from $661 to $6,024.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,353.
How expensive are 76247 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 76247 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$767 to $9,218 - averaging $2,798 for the location.
